Lockstep: Announces Strategic Investment From Amex Ventures

  • Lockstep connects the world’s accounts receivable (AR) and accounts payable (AP) departments so they can work better together
  • American Express is a globally integrated payments company, providing customers with access to products, insights
  • The investment, which finishes out the A+ round, will be used to expand personnel in the product, engineering, and marketing
  • Announced their Series A in February of this year led by Point72 Ventures with participation from Clocktower Ventures
  • Integrates with cloud and on-premise Enterprise Resource Planning and accounting solutions
  • Seeks to modernize businesses where it is needed most – accounting and finance departments
